DMA memory allocation support
configname: CONFIG_ZONE_DMA
Linux Kernel Configuration
└─> Processor type and features
└─> DMA memory allocation support
DMA memory allocation support allows devices with less than 32-bit
addressing to allocate within the first 16MB of address space.
Disable if no such devices will be used.
If unsure, say Y.
